The demand of steel mills weakens and the price of vanadium falls in the market [SMM vanadium spot KuaiBao]

[SMM Vanadium Daily Review: steel mill demand weakening vanadium market price] Today, the mainstream transaction price of vanadium was 12.4-128000 yuan / ton in cash, down 1250 yuan / ton compared with last Friday; the mainstream transaction price of ferrovanadium was 12.6-128000 yuan / ton in cash, down 2000 yuan / ton compared with last Friday; and the mainstream transaction price of vanadium-nitrogen alloy was 18.3-187000 yuan / ton, down 4000 yuan / ton compared with last Friday.

According to SMM, the price quoted by large domestic manufacturers of vanadium-nitrogen alloy is 196000 yuan / ton, which is 1000 yuan / ton higher than the last time, but this price adjustment still has little effect on the market and does not prevent the price of vanadium-nitrogen alloy from falling. Recently, the recruitment of vanadium alloy steel is weakening, and the reduction of demand makes the purchase demand of vanadium alloy for high-priced sheet vanadium weakens, and the price of sheet vanadium begins to fall after the quotation of large factories. With the decline of sheet vanadium prices, the cost support of ferrovanadium and vanadium-nitrogen alloys is weakened, and the downstream demand is weak, so the prices of ferrovanadium and vanadium-nitrogen alloys fall.

SMM believes that after this round of price decline, there may be a new round of positive prices for vanadium, but due to shipments by some manufacturers at the end of the month, the price of vanadium may fall slightly in the near future; vanadium iron due to the existence of demand problems, the price will fall to a certain extent; vanadium nitrogen alloy prices and sheet vanadium prices are relatively close, will follow the drop of vanadium in the near future, but the decline is limited.
